*{scroll-behavior:smooth}body{font-family:Arial,Helvetica,sans-serif;margin:0;min-height:100vh;display:flex;flex-direction:column;justify-content:space-between}a:visited,a:hover,a:active,a:focus{text-decoration:none}a p{margin:0}header{background-color:#fff;width:100%;-webkit-box-shadow:0 5px 8px 0 rgb(0 0 0 / 27%);-moz-box-shadow:0 5px 8px 0 rgb(0 0 0 / 27%);box-shadow:0 5px 8px 0 rgb(0 0 0 / 27%);z-index:1;position:fixed;top:-1px}header a{color:#0000C9;text-decoration:none}.header-content{padding:24px 64px;margin-left:auto;margin-right:auto;max-width:1440px;display:flex;flex-direction:row-reverse;align-items:center;position:relative}.header-content img{width:120px;z-index:3}.welcome{background:url(/images/6960dd12abce3ddd91b38dc7c4bdf25e.png);background-size:100% 100%;background-repeat:no-repeat;margin-top:4px}.welcome-content{width:100%;max-width:1440px;margin-left:auto;margin-right:auto;padding-top:96px;display:flex;justify-content:center;align-items:center}.welcome-text{width:25%}.welcome-content img{width:36%}h1{margin:0;font-weight:400;font-size:40px;color:#00004E;margin-right:48px}h1.page-title p{margin:0}p.site-presentation{text-align:justify;margin-right:48px;color:#383838}.product-presentation{display:flex;align-items:center;justify-content:space-between;width:90%;max-width:1440px;margin-left:auto;margin-right:auto;margin-top:72px;-webkit-box-shadow:4px 4px 16px 0 rgb(0 0 0 / 10%);-moz-box-shadow:4px 4px 16px 0 rgb(0 0 0 / 10%);box-shadow:4px 4px 16px 0 rgb(0 0 0 / 10%);border-radius:8px;overflow:hidden}.product-presentation img{width:50%}.leaflet{padding-left:40px;padding-right:40px;display:flex;flex-direction:column}.leaflet h2{color:#383838;margin:0}.leaflet h2 p{margin:0}.leaflet a{background:#fff;padding:16px 32px;border-radius:25px;color:#0000C9;text-decoration:none;width:max-content;font-weight:600;margin-top:12px;border:2px solid #0000C9}.leaflet a:hover{color:#fff;background:#0000C9}p.text-card{color:#6F6F6F}.card-container{margin-top:56px;display:flex;flex-wrap:wrap;justify-content:flex-start;width:90%;margin-left:auto;margin-right:auto;max-width:1440px}.card-container .card{width:25%;margin:24px 4%;padding:24px;box-shadow:4px 4px 16px 0 rgb(0 0 0 / 10%);border-radius:8px;display:flex;flex-direction:column;justify-content:space-between}.card-container .card .card-blue-btn{text-decoration:none;text-align:center;display:block;background:#fff;padding:16px 0;border-radius:25px;color:#0000C9;font-weight:600;margin-top:16px;border:2px solid #0000C9}.card-container .card .card-blue-btn:hover{background:#0000C9;color:#fff}.card-container .card h3{color:#383838}.card-container .card h3 p{margin-top:0;margin-bottom:0}.card-container .card p:not(.card-container .card h3 p):not(.card-container .card a p),.leaflet p:not(.leaflet h2 p):not(.leaflet a p){margin-top:8px;margin-bottom:8px;color:#6F6F6F}footer{width:90%;max-width:1440px;margin-left:auto;margin-right:auto;margin-top:40px;padding-bottom:24px}footer p{text-align:justify;font-size:12px;color:#A1AAB1}footer img{width:160px}.footer-navbar{display:flex;align-items:center;justify-content:space-between;margin-top:32px;width:80%}.footer-navbar a{color:#383838;text-decoration:none;font-weight:600;font-size:14px}.footer-navbar.footer-error-page a{text-align:center}.terms.footer-navbar{justify-content:start}.terms.footer-navbar a{margin-left:160px}.header-content .links{padding-top:120px;box-shadow:inset 0 0 2000px rgba(255,255,255,.5);height:100vh;width:33%;min-width:475px;transform:translate(-150%);display:flex;flex-direction:column;margin-left:-40px;padding-left:50px;transition:transform 0.5s ease-in-out;text-align:center;position:fixed;top:0;left:0;background:#fff}.header-content input[type="checkbox"]:checked~.links{transform:translateX(0)}.header-content .checkbox{position:absolute;height:32px;width:32px;top:33px;left:72px;z-index:5;opacity:0;cursor:pointer}.header-content .hamburger-lines{height:26px;width:32px;position:absolute;top:38px;left:72px;z-index:2;display:flex;flex-direction:column;justify-content:space-between}.header-content .hamburger-lines .line{display:block;height:4px;width:100%;border-radius:10px;background:#0000C9}.header-content .hamburger-lines .line1{transform-origin:0% 0%;transition:transform 0.4s ease-in-out}.header-content .hamburger-lines .line2{transition:transform 0.2s ease-in-out}.header-content .hamburger-lines .line3{transform-origin:0% 100%;transition:transform 0.4s ease-in-out}.header-content input[type="checkbox"]:checked~.hamburger-lines .line1{transform:rotate(45deg)}.header-content input[type="checkbox"]:checked~.hamburger-lines .line2{transform:scaleY(0)}.header-content input[type="checkbox"]:checked~.hamburger-lines .line3{transform:rotate(-45deg)}.links a{margin:40px auto;width:70%;text-align:start}.mobile-logo{display:none}h1.outside-title{margin-left:auto;margin-right:auto;margin-top:80px;width:90%;max-width:1440px}.paragraph-container{margin-top:40px}.paragraph{margin-left:auto;margin-right:auto;margin-top:16px;width:90%;max-width:1440px;color:#383838;text-align:justify}.return-link{display:flex;align-items:center;justify-content:space-between;color:#5455A9;font-size:18px;font-weight:600;text-decoration:none;width:80px;margin-left:5%;margin-top:24px}.return-link img{width:16%;max-width:32px}.info-container{width:100%;max-width:1440px;margin-left:auto;margin-right:auto;margin-top:40px;text-align:center}.info-container img{width:50%}img.center{margin:0;position:absolute;top:50%;left:50%;-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:75%;max-width:400px}.video-container{position:fixed;top:0;left:0;width:100%;height:100%;backdrop-filter:blur(10px);background-color:rgb(99 99 99 / 40%);z-index:3;display:none}.video-browser{width:90%;max-width:720px;margin:0;position:absolute;top:50%;left:50%;-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.close-window{margin-top:40px;width:54px;height:54px;background:#0000C9;color:#fff;font-size:24px;line-height:54px;text-align:center;border-radius:50px;font-weight:600;margin-right:24px;margin-left:auto;cursor:pointer;z-index:9;position:relative}.bc-player-g2OtgoAoBs_default.vjs-fluid.vjs-16-9:not(.vjs-audio-only-mode),.bc-player-g2OtgoAoBs_default.vjs-fluid:not(.vjs-audio-only-mode){border-radius:10px}.display-video-player{cursor:pointer}.vjs-poster{background:#fff url(/images/88961d449e9ea9d427e8c267cdf9d50d.png) no-repeat center!important}.errorpage-container{margin:0 auto;display:flex;justify-content:center;flex-direction:column;width:100%}.error-title{color:#0000C9;font-size:96px;margin-bottom:0;margin-right:0}a.error-link{color:#003fe2;text-decoration:none}#external-link-modal .modal{background-color:rgb(75 75 75 / 64%);backdrop-filter:blur(10px)}#external-link-modal .btn-primary{background-color:#0000C9;border-color:#0000C9}#external-link-modal .btn-secondary{background:#fff;color:#0000C9;border-color:#0000C9}#external-link-modal .btn{border:3px solid #0000C9;font-weight:600}#external-link-modal .modal-header{border:none;padding:0}#external-link-modal .modal-header .close{position:absolute;top:24px;right:24px;opacity:unset}#external-link-modal .modal-header .close span{font-size:40px;color:#0000C9}#external-link-modal .modal-body h2{color:#0000C9}#external-link-modal .modal-content{padding:16px}#external-link-modal .modal-body p{color:#6F6F6F}#external-link-modal .modal-body p a{color:#6F6F6F;text-decoration:none}#external-link-modal .modal-footer{justify-content:center}.btn.btn-primary,.btn.btn-secondary{cursor:pointer}#external-link-modal .btn-secondary:hover{color:#0000C9;background-color:#fff;border-color:#0000C9}#external-link-modal .btn-primary:hover{background-color:#0000C9;border-color:#0000C9}#external-link-modal .modal-footer{border:none}.error-explanation{width:90%;max-width:1440px;margin-left:auto;margin-right:auto}.error-sugestions{width:90%;max-width:1440px;margin-left:auto;margin-right:auto}.error-sugestions a{color:#000;}.error-sugestions a{text-decoration:underline}h3.subtitle-blue{margin-left:auto;margin-right:auto;margin-top:16px;width:90%;max-width:1440px;color:#00004E}a.card-white-btn{text-decoration:none;text-align:center;display:block;background:#fff;padding:16px 0;border-radius:25px;color:#0000C9;font-weight:600;margin-top:16px;border:2px solid #0000C9}a.card-white-btn:hover{color:#fff;background:#0000C9}hr.blue-header-line{height:4px;background:#0095ff;border:none;width:48px;margin-right:auto;margin-left:0}img.contact-img{width:48px}@media (max-width:1120px){h1{font-size:32px}.footer-navbar{width:100%}}@media (max-width:1020px){.card-container .card{width:40%}}@media (max-width:950px){.welcome-content{flex-direction:column-reverse}.welcome-text{width:75%;margin-bottom:24px;margin-top:24px}.product-presentation{flex-direction:column}.product-presentation img{width:100%;border-radius:8px}.leaflet{margin-top:32px;margin-bottom:32px}}@media(max-width:800px){.header-content{padding:24px 4px}.header-content img{margin-right:32px}}@media (max-width:768px){.card-container{margin-top:24px}.card-container .card{width:100%;margin:24px 0}.leaflet a{width:100%;text-align:center;display:block;padding:16px 0}footer img{display:none}.mobile-logo{display:block;margin-bottom:40px}.footer-navbar{flex-direction:column;margin-top:64px}.footer-navbar a{width:100%;text-align:start;margin:16px 0}.terms.footer-navbar a{margin-left:0;text-align:center}.info-container img{width:90%}.header-content .links{width:111%;min-width:unset}.header-content .hamburger-lines{left:32px}.header-content .checkbox{left:32px}}@media (min-width:576px){#external-link-modal .modal-dialog{max-width:630px}}@media (max-width:550px){.welcome-content img{width:100%}.mobile-logo{width:80px}}